Iran Launches Drone Strike on Kuwait, Targeting Government Facilities Near U.S. Military Presence
Iran launched a drone attack against Kuwait early Saturday, targeting government facilities in the country's north and areas near Bubiyan Island. Kuwaiti air defenses intercepted the drones, preventing casualties, though several facilities sustained damage. The attack comes amid renewed military tensions between Iran and the United States, with Tehran also issuing fresh threats to regional nations cooperating with Washington.
Iran launched a drone attack against Kuwait early Saturday, marking another escalation in the growing confrontation between Tehran and the United States.
Kuwait's Ministry of Defense said its air defense systems detected hostile drones entering Kuwaiti airspace before dawn and successfully intercepted them. The ministry reported that several government facilities in northern Kuwait and areas near Bubiyan Island were damaged, but no injuries or fatalities were reported.
Attack Follows Strikes Near U.S. Military Base
The latest strike comes after Iran reportedly targeted the U.S. Al Salem Air Base in Kuwait several times during the renewed military confrontation with the United States. The continued attacks highlight the expanding regional security threat as Iran increases pressure on countries hosting American forces.
Iran Issues Warning to Regional Governments
Ali Abdollahi, commander of Iran's Khatam al-Anbiya Central Headquarters, warned Islamic nations against maintaining close military cooperation with the United States.
"Countries that continue serving as America's shield will find themselves consumed by the flames of war," Abdollahi said.
He also accused the United States of using regional countries and their strategic infrastructure to protect its military interests while supporting Israel's security, claiming neighboring governments would ultimately bear the consequences of Washington's actions.
Regional Tensions Continue to Rise
The drone attack underscores the growing instability across the Gulf as Iran expands its military operations beyond direct confrontations with U.S. forces. Despite the damage, Kuwait avoided casualties thanks to its air defense response, but the latest strike raises concerns that the conflict could spread further across the region.
